Output 523b33b66ddefb0dc5e153c93e03e41208970cced7cb539e3c856363cce53de2:0

value
156358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e511b8b5ba5ec112c6319f33dbdf8571b2f4cb OP_EQUAL
address
36WhUXZR7DEeDktNLty6Cwn9fiWamaRpYo
transaction
523b33b66ddefb0dc5e153c93e03e41208970cced7cb539e3c856363cce53de2